I am living with the inability to write (dysgraphia), to do arithmetic (dyscalculia), to see or feel fingers (finger agnosia) and to tell left from right (left-right disorientation). The name given for this is Gerstmann Syndrome, a brain disease acquired after bleeding in the brain during a stroke or traumatic head injury. As a kid, there was not much I could aspire to be, because even one single story of someone overcoming the inability to write, to do arithmetic, to see or feel fingers, and to tell left from right to find success in a career does not exist. So I did not quite know if people like me could have a career, or contribute to society. I tell myself it is not about having the skill to do something, it is about having the will, desire, and commitment to be your best. I think the challenge of finding success is what pushes me to my goals and beyond.
